Everything you need to listen to the web

One click to start listening. Works on news, blogs, documentation, Google Docs, and any page with text.

🔊

Read Any Page Aloud

Click the icon or press Alt+Shift+R on any webpage. MurMur extracts the article, strips away clutter, and starts reading instantly.

📝

Google Docs Support

One of the few TTS extensions that works with Google Docs. A "Read Aloud" button appears right in your toolbar.

Real-Time Highlighting

Every word lights up as it's spoken. The current word is highlighted in yellow so you always know exactly where you are.

🎨

Two Reading Modes

Overlay mode gives you a clean, distraction-free reader. Inline mode highlights words directly on the original page.

🤖

AI Voices That Run Locally

Hundreds of natural-sounding Piper AI voices run entirely in your browser via WebAssembly. No data leaves your machine.

🌍

30+ Languages

From English and Spanish to Icelandic and Swahili. MurMur auto-detects the page language and filters voices accordingly.

Adjustable Speed

0.5x to 3x with natural pitch at every speed. Piper voices adjust at synthesis time so faster never sounds distorted.

⌨️

Full Keyboard Control

Space to play/pause, arrows to navigate and adjust speed, Escape to close. No mouse needed.

💬

Custom Pronunciation

Built-in rules for abbreviations, units, and citations. Add your own see-say rules and they sync across devices.

Your data stays yours

MurMur is built on a simple principle: your browsing data never leaves your browser.

🚫

No Account Required

Install and start using immediately. No sign-up, no email, no login.

🔒

No Data Collection

MurMur doesn't track, store, or transmit any of your browsing or reading data.

💻

Local AI Processing

Piper AI voices run entirely in your browser using WebAssembly. Nothing is sent to external servers.

🔍

Minimal Permissions

Only requests what's strictly necessary: active tab access, TTS, and local storage for your preferences.
